Ordinals
beta
Sat 1965572843301168
decimal
834916.343301168
degree
0°204916′292″343301168‴
percentile
93.59870692682377%
name
xsruxobmof
cycle
0
epoch
3
period
414
block
834916
offset
343301168
timestamp
2024-03-16 11:18:49 UTC
rarity
common
prev
next